I really wanted to give the new Fractured Card Layout Die a try. So I grabbed the Birthday Meows 6x6 Paper Pad and trimmed a few pieces of the pattern paper to fit over the die. I secured them on the back of the die with a piece of washi tape. I love how quick and easy this design was to make!


I stamped the adorable kitty from Newton's Heart Stamp Set on white card stock using Memento Tuxedo Black ink. I then stamped it again on a scrap of the pink pattern paper. I Copic colored the kitty on white card stock and die cut it using the coordinating Newton's Heart Die Set. And I fussy cut the pattern paper heart and paper pieced it to the kitty.


I wanted the kitty to fit in with the birthday theme just a bit more so I also stamped the party hat and present from the Newton's Birthday Delights Stamp Set. I colored them with my Copic markers and then die cut them using the coordinating Newton's Birthday Delights Die Set. The sentiment also comes from the Newton's Birthday Delights Stamp Set. I masked the bottom portion of the sentiment using a post-it note when I inked it up. I removed the post-it note and then stamped the sentiment. I did this a couple of times in my mini misti to get a nice crisp stamped 'partial' sentiment. I trimmed it up and then adhered it directly to the card.

I had a fun idea to make two cute Valentine's Day cards using the sketch and they turned out cuter than I thought they would. This sketch is so easy to duplicate once you have the measurements figured out! I love it! 


I die cut the background papers using the largest scalloped die from the Frames & Flags Die Set. I used scraps of striped pattern papers cut down to 1-3/4" wide for my next layer. I also die cut these with the largest scalloped die so it fits just right on the background layer.


I used the adorable Love & Meows 6x6 Paper Pad for my first card. I paired up the papers with the super cute Newton's Heart Stamp Set. The top layer with the fishtail bottom measures 3 x 4". I found the center of the paper and measure up about 1/2" and drew lines from the corner to the center point and then fussy cut my fishtails. I sure hope that makes sense!


I stamped the adorable kitty, pup and sentiments using Memento Tuxedo Black ink. I colored them up with my Copic markers and used the coordinating Newton's Heart Die Set to die cut the kitty and the Puppy Heart Die Set to die cut the puppy. 

Here's a quick list of the Copic Markers I used for the kitty: R00, R20, N0, N1, N3, YR21, YR15, Colorless Blender.


For my second card I used the cute Love & Woofs 6x6 Paper Pad and the sweet Puppy Heart Stamp Set. Love the fun sentiments in these stamp sets!

Here's a quick list of the Copic Markers I used for the puppy: N1, N3, N5, E51, E21, E23, E25.


I also stamped the kitty and pup on scraps of pattern paper and fussy cut the hearts. I used a Memento Tuxedo Black marker to color the edges of my fussy cutting to neaten them up and adhered them to the hearts on the kitty and pup.


I die cut a scalloped stitched circle from vellum card stock using a circle die from the Circle Frames Die Set. I love to add a layer of vellum when I don't want to cover up my background completely, but I want a little something between my focal image and the background. I adhered the kitty and pup to the vellum and then adhered the vellum circles by adding glue just behind the kitty and pup. That way none of the glue shows through the vellum and gives the card a bit of dimension since the vellum doesn't lay down completely flat.

I cut the pretty pink papers to 4-1/4 x 5-1/2" for my card front layer and adhered it to my white A2 top fold card base measuring 4-1/4 x 11"; scored at 5-1/2". 


I die cut the 'i love you' pattern papers with the second largest postage stamp die from the Postage Stamp {nesting dies} also from Unity (currently out of stock). I adhered it directly to the card. I adhered the ladybug to the bottom of the heart with a bit of liquid glue and then added foam tape to the back of both. I popped them up on the card and then finished it off with a few Translucent enamel dots from Gina Marie Designs. I think it turned out pretty cute!

Once I designed my card, I thought... why not make a few? So, I ended up making half a dozen. I really love the way they turned out. I started by cutting all of my card stock from card bases to layers. I don't usually do this but I thought it would make sense since I planned on doing multiples.




I then stamped the angels by using two ink pads, Aqua Mist and Ripe Avocado. I masked the angel and stamped the wings with Aqua Mist. I stamped the stars using Harvest Gold... and then decided to stamp over that with Lemon Tart and it brightened the yellow a bit. I stamped the sentiment using Memento Tuxedo black ink. I was going to doodle some strings for the stars hanging down, but I decided to add some gold twine. I punched some 1/8" holes at the top of the stars. I pulled through some gold twine and taped them to the back of the circle. I then tied a bunch of little bows and adhered them using Ranger Multi Medium Matte.




I adhered all my layers on each of the cards. I did pop up the circle pieces and the little hearts. I had a lot of fun making these and I think they turned out pretty cute!
